The College of Science for Girls at the University of Baghdad discussed the master’s thesis titled (Analysis of the effect of lighting conditions on the ability to detect and calculate the speed of a moving object in the visual system) by the student (Batool Redha Abd).
The thesis aims to design an intelligent optical system to detect moving objects and calculate their speed
The message also included recording video clips of a moving virtual object (balls) in different colors. The filming was done under different lighting conditions. RCNN technology was relied upon and compared using the ALEXNET program
The work was done by taking a different number of classes and a different number of training times and studying the efficiency standards to test the quality and efficiency of work to detect moving objects under different conditions
The most important recommendations reached by the study are the proposal to apply the system to detect transparent objects, in addition to applying the system in a visual environment that contains variables such as the difference in speed, distance, and angle of fall of the objects
The proposed system can be applied to a number of different applications, especially traffic control and collision warning systems, as well as tracking and detecting fish underwater, as well as missiles and satellite
